Графический редактор схем v1.2: Большое обновление — умный редактор компонентов.

В прошлой статье мы знакомили вас с первой версией нашего «Графического редактора схем от Arduino-tex.ru». Мы создавали этот инструмент с простой целью: дать радиолюбителям, студентам и преподавателям возможность быстро набросать понятную схему без изучения сложных профессиональных САПР.

Благодаря вашим отзывам и нашей работе над ошибками, мы рады представить версию 1.2.

Благодаря вашим отзывам и нашей работе над ошибками, мы рады представить версию 1.2. Мы сохранили простоту, за которую вы полюбили первую версию, но кардинально улучшили удобство работы и добавили функции, о которых вы просили.

Где скачать?

Программа является бесплатной и распространяется по принципу "как есть".

Скачать Графический редактор схем v1.2 на «Бусти».


Что нового в версии 1.2?

Если кратко, то рисовать стало удобнее, а создавать свои компоненты — в разы быстрее.

Что нового в версии 1.2?

  1. Обновленная библиотека элементов: Компоненты в правой панели теперь расположены в 3 колонки (вместо одной), у каждого есть подпись, а сверху появился умный поиск.
  2. Расширенная палитра: Теперь доступно огромное количество цветов для проводов и текста — от пастельных тонов до неона.
  3. Работа с текстом 2.0: Добавлены рамки, фон, кнопки изменения размера («+» и «-») и смена цвета уже созданной надписи.
  4. Умный редактор компонентов: Автоматическое удаление белого фона, автообрезка и — самое главное — масштабирование детали по двум точкам (под реальный размер 2.54 мм).
  5. Навигация: Перемещаться по полю теперь можно не только мышкой, но и стрелками на клавиатуре.

Умный редактор компонентов.

Подробный разбор изменений.

1. Комфорт в мелочах: Интерфейс и Поиск.

Комфорт в мелочах: Интерфейс и Поиск

В предыдущей версии, если у вас было много компонентов, приходилось долго листать список. В v1.2 мы сделали правую панель шире: элементы выстраиваются в три ряда. Но главное нововведение — Поиск. Просто начните вводить «res» или «esp» в поле сверху, и программа мгновенно отфильтрует лишнее, оставив только нужные детали. Работает даже вставка текста через Ctrl+V.

2. Оформление текста.

 Оформление текста.

Текстовые метки стали полноценным инструментом оформления. Выделите любую надпись на схеме, и в нижней панели станут активны новые кнопки:

  • Фон: Добавляет подложку под текст (удобно, если надпись перекрывает провода).
  • Обводка: Добавляет рамку вокруг текста.
  • Размер (+/-): Больше не нужно угадывать размер шрифта при создании. Изменяйте его на лету.
  • Цвет: Выделите текст и нажмите на любой цвет в палитре, чтобы перекрасить его.

3. Навигация.

Для тех, кто работает на тачпаде или любит точность: теперь холст можно сдвигать стрелками клавиатуры (Вверх, Вниз, Влево, Вправо). Привычное перемещение зажатым колесиком мыши (СКМ) тоже осталось.


Главная фишка: Умный редактор компонентов.

Мы полностью переписали режим создания своих деталей. Раньше вам приходилось вручную подгонять картинку под сетку. Теперь программа делает это за вас.

Главная фишка: Умный редактор компонентов.

Новые инструменты в режиме «Редактор»:

  • Удалить белый фон: Загрузили картинку из интернета (JPEG), а у нее белый квадрат вокруг? Нажмите одну кнопку — программа аккуратно удалит фон, оставив саму деталь и даже надписи внутри неё нетронутыми.
  • Авто-обрезка: Убирает пустые прозрачные поля вокруг детали, чтобы рамка выделения плотно прилегала к компоненту.
  • Масштабирование по 2 точкам: Киллер-фича обновления. Вы просто указываете программе два соседних контакта, и она сама подгоняет размер картинки под стандартный шаг 2.54 мм (или 5.0 мм).

Практика: Добавляем ESP32 S3 mini за 1 минуту.

ESP32 S3 mini

Давайте опробуем новые функции и добавим плату ESP32 S3 mini.

Практика: Добавляем ESP32 S3 mini за 1 минуту.

Шаг 1. Подготовка Зайдите в режим «Редактор» и нажмите «Выбрать изображение». Загрузите фото вашей платы (можно даже скриншот с белым фоном).

Подготовка Зайдите в режим «Редактор» и нажмите «Выбрать изображение».

Шаг 2. Чистка (Новая функция) Если картинка имеет белый фон, нажмите кнопку «Удалить белый фон». Фон исчезнет. Затем нажмите «Авто-обрезка», чтобы убрать лишние границы.

Шаг 2. Чистка (Новая функция) Если картинка имеет белый фон, нажмите кнопку «Удалить белый фон».

Шаг 3. Масштабирование (Новая функция) Плата должна идеально вставать в сетку редактора. Мы знаем, что расстояние между ножками (пинами) у ESP32 — 2.54 мм.

  1. Наведите курсор на центр первого контакта (отверстия) и нажмите ПКМ (правую кнопку мыши). Появится голубая точка.
  2. Наведите курсор на центр соседнего контакта и снова нажмите ПКМ.
  3. Нажмите кнопку «Под 2.54мм» внизу экрана. Магия! Изображение само увеличится или уменьшится до нужного размера.

 Масштабирование (Новая функция) Плата должна идеально вставать в сетку редактора.

Шаг 4. Расстановка контактов Нажмите «Готово -> Контакты». Теперь просто прокликайте ПКМ все выводы платы. Они будут идеально совпадать с сеткой.

Теперь просто прокликайте ПКМ все выводы платы. Они будут идеально совпадать с сеткой.

Шаг 5. Сохранение Введите название: ESP32 S3 Mini. Введите псевдоним (на латинице): esp32s3. Нажмите «Сохранить компонент».

Шаг 5. Сохранение Введите название: ESP32 S3 Mini.

Теперь вернитесь в главное меню, введите в поиске "esp", и ваш новый компонент готов к работе!

Теперь вернитесь в главное меню, введите в поиске.


Основы работы (для новичков).

Если вы пропустили прошлую статью, напомним базовые принципы, которые остались неизменными.

Структура файлов.

Программа портативная (не требует установки).

Графический редактор схем.exe — Это главный файл для запуска программы.

  • Графический редактор схем.exe — запуск.
  • assets/ — здесь хранятся картинки ваших компонентов.
  • my_components.json — ваша личная библиотека. Этот файл можно скинуть другу, и у него появятся ваши компоненты.

Управление и горячие клавиши (обновлено)

Клавиша / Действие Описание
ЛКМ Выделение / Перемещение / Рисование провода.
ПКМ Отмена рисования / Добавление точки в редакторе.
СКМ (Колесо) Зажать для перемещения холста.
Стрелки Перемещение холста (Новое!).
Del Удалить выделенный объект.
R Повернуть объект.
Ctrl + C / V Копировать / Вставить.
Ctrl (при рисовании) Рисовать прямые линии (90 градусов).
Двойной клик по тексту Редактирование текста.

Как собрать схему?

  1. Перетащите компоненты из правой панели (используйте поиск!).
  2. Соедините их проводами (клик по красному пину -> клик по другому пину).
  3. Добавьте текст (кнопка "Текст"), настройте его размер и фон.
  4. Сохраните проект (.json), чтобы доделать потом, или экспортируйте картинку (PNG/JPEG), чтобы поделиться с миром.

Как собрать схему?


Заключение.

Версия 1.2 — это большой шаг вперед. Мы постарались сделать работу с элементами комфортнее, добавив поиск и 3 колонки, а процесс создания своих компонентов превратили из рутины в удовольствие благодаря авто-масштабированию.

Программа является бесплатной и распространяется по принципу "как есть".

Скачать Графический редактор схем v1.2 на «Бусти».

Обсуждение, предложения и обмен файлами компонентов (my_components.json) доступны в нашем "Обсуждении в ВК".


Творите, создавайте новые схемы и делитесь ими с сообществом!


Понравилась статья Графический редактор схем v1.2 от Arduino-tex.ru? Не забудь поделиться с друзьями в соц. сетях.

А также подписаться на наш канал на VK Видео, вступить в группу Вконтакте.

Спасибо за внимание!

Технологии начинаются с простого!


Фотографии к статье

Файлы для скачивания

Схема из статьи Схема из статьи.json7 Kb 30 Скачать
Картинка для тестов esp32 c3 Картинка для тестов esp32 c3.jpg45 Kb 35 Скачать
Графический редактор схем v1.2 Графический редактор схем v1.2.zip34000 Kb 89 Скачать

Комментарии

Ваше Имя*


Разработка проектов
EasyHMI
Умный Дом